OpenMediaVault (OMV)是一個專為網絡附加儲存(NAS)設計的自由Linux發行版[2][3]。專案的首席開發者為Volker Theile,他於2009年建立了此專案。OMV以Debian作業系統為基礎,並以GPLv3特許。
此條目需要更新。 (2022年3月11日) |
背景
到2009年底為止,Volker Theile是FreeNAS唯一的活躍開發者,FreeNAS是Olivier Cochard-Labbé從2005年開始從m0n0wall衍生開發的NAS作業系統[4][5][6]。m0n0wall是FreeBSD作業系統的變體,而Theile決定以Linux核心為基礎重寫FreeNAS。幾個月前,專案團隊就知道FreeNAS需要大量重寫才能支援重要功能[5]。因為Cochard-Labbé比較喜歡以FreeBSD為基礎的系統,他與Theile都同意Theile必須以不同的名稱開發他的Linux版本[4];一開始此專案名為coreNAS,但在幾天之後,Theile捨棄了這個名字而改用OpenMediaVault[6]。
同時,FreeNAS仍然需要重寫與維護。為了實現這個目標,Cochard-Labbé將開發交給了iXsystems,一家開發TrueOS作業系統的美國公司[5][6]。
技術設計
Theile選擇了Debian作為該系統的構建平台,因為其軟件套件管理系統中的大量軟件代表了他不必花時間自己重新打包軟件[7]。OpenMediaVault對Debian作業系統做出了一些變更。其提供了一個用於管理與自訂的以網頁為基礎的用戶介面,以及用於實作新功能的外掛程式API。可以透過網頁介面安裝外掛程式[8][9]。
發佈歷史
每個OpenMediaVault版本,Theile都會從弗蘭克·赫伯特的《沙丘》小說中選取開發代號[10]。
圖例: | 舊版本 | 目前版本 | 最新預覽版本 |
---|
版本 | 名稱 | 發佈日期 | 結束支援日期 | 基底 | 備註 |
---|---|---|---|---|---|
0.2 | Ix | 2011-10-17[11] | Debian 6 | 以Ix行星命名。 | |
0.3 | Omnius | 2012-04-18[12] | 2012-12-30[13] | Debian 6 | 引入多語言的網頁介面,並透過存取控制串列進行權限管理。此版本以Omnius命名,其為《沙丘》系列中一個有感知能力的電腦網絡。 |
0.4 | Fedaykin | 2012-09-21[14][15] | 2013-12-09[16] | Debian 6 | 以Fremen的Fedaykin突擊隊命名。 |
0.5 | Sardaukar | 2013-08-25[17] | Debian 6 | 修訂後的API會讓v0.4的外掛程式不相容[17]。 | |
1.0 | Kralizec | 2014-09-15[18] | 2015-12-26[19] | Debian 7 | 改善對較低階系統的支援;新增了支援小工具的儀錶板;改善外掛程式的基礎設施。此版本以Kralizec命名,這是一場被預測將於宇宙盡頭發生的戰鬥。 |
2.0 | Stone burner | 2015-06-29[20][21] | 2017-12-06[22] | Debian 7 | 使用Sencha ExtJS 5.1.1框架編寫WebGUI;修改後的GUI支援設置WiFi、VLAN等等。 |
3.0 | Erasmus[23] | 2017-06-13 | 2018-07-09[24] | Debian 8 | 以機械人Erasmus命名。 |
4.0 | Arrakis[25] | 2018-05-08 | 2020-06-30[26] | Debian 9 | |
[27] | 5.0Usul[28] | 2020-03-30 | Debian 10 |
參見
- 直連式儲存 (DAS)
- 儲存區域網絡 (SAN)
- TrueNAS(曾名為 FreeNAS)- 以FreeBSD為基礎的NAS作業系統,OpenMediaVault最初是自其分支出來的
- Nexenta OS - 以基於ZFS的核心為基礎的開放原始碼作業系統與企業級NAS
- Openfiler - 以CentOS為基礎的NAS作業系統
- Windows Home Server
- XigmaNAS - 另一個以FreeBSD為基礎的NAS作業系統,XigmaNAS是2005年至2011年底開發的原始FreeNAS程式碼的延續
- Zentyal
參考資料
外部連結
Wikiwand - on
Seamless Wikipedia browsing. On steroids.